Abstract

We propose an optimized mapping rule for the 32-point four-dimensional cross-constellation for high-speed optical communications based on bit-interleaved coded-modulation with iterative decoding. The optimized mapping outperforms its random counterpart by 1 dB in terms of OSNR sensitivity.
